在当今数字时代,信息的安全传输与存储至关重要。加密技术作为网络安全的基石,其有效性并非依赖单一方法,而是由几个相互关联、相辅相成的核心要素共同构建。理解这些要素,是评估和部署任何安全方案的关键。本文将系统阐述构成可靠加密体系的四大基本要素。
第一要素:机密性 - 确保信息私密
机密性是加密技术最广为人知的目标。其核心在于通过特定的算法和密钥,将可读的明文信息转换为不可读的密文,确保只有授权的接收者才能解密并读取原始内容。这依赖于强大的加密算法(如AES、RSA)和严格的密钥管理。没有机密性,敏感数据在传输过程中就如同明信片,可能被任意第三方窥视。
第二要素:完整性 - 防止数据篡改
仅仅保密还不够,还必须确保信息在传输或存储过程中未被意外或恶意地篡改、破坏。完整性验证机制(如哈希函数SHA-256、消息认证码MAC)能够为数据生成一个独特的“数字指纹”。接收方通过比对指纹,即可高效地验证所接收的数据是否与发送时完全一致,任何细微改动都会被察觉。
第三要素:身份验证 - 确认通信方身份
此要素旨在确认信息发送者和接收者的真实身份,防止冒名顶替。它回答“你声称的身份是否真实?”这一问题。常见的实现方式包括数字证书、用户名/密码、生物特征识别等。结合加密技术,身份验证能确保您正在与正确的服务器通信(例如网站HTTPS证书),从而有效防范中间人攻击。
第四要素:不可否认性 - 落实行为责任
不可否认性提供了法律和追责层面的保障,意味着信息的发送者事后无法否认其发送行为及内容。这通常通过数字签名技术实现。发送者用其私钥对信息生成签名,接收者可用公开的公钥验证该签名。由于私钥的唯一性和私密性,该签名即成为发送者行为的有效证据。
协同作用:构建全方位安全防线
这四大要素并非孤立存在,而是紧密交织,共同构建起立体化的安全防线。例如,安全的通信协议(如TLS/SSL)便同时运用了所有要素:利用加密实现机密性,利用哈希和MAC确保完整性,利用数字证书完成身份验证,并利用数字签名提供不可否认性。只有这四个要素齐备并得到恰当实施,才能建立起一个真正可信、可审计的数字安全环境。
理解加密技术的这四个基本要素,有助于我们在选择安全产品、制定安全策略时做出更明智的决策,为我们的数字资产和信息隐私构筑起坚实的核心屏障。